It appears the upcoming Samsung Galaxy A27 is nearing its official debut. The Galaxy A27 is expected to join Samsung’s latest Galaxy A-series lineup, which already includes the Galaxy A37 and Galaxy A57. Among the three devices, the Galaxy A27 is likely to be positioned as the most affordable option.
Galaxy A27 has now been spotted on the FCC certification platform in multiple variants. Since FCC approval is typically one of the final regulatory steps before a device reaches the market, the latest development suggests that the Galaxy A27 may be unveiled soon. Here are more details.
According to a report by 91mobiles, the Galaxy A27 has appeared on the FCC certification website with model numbers SM-A276U and SM-A276B. These are believed to represent the US and global variants of the device.
Although the certification does not reveal any hardware specifications, its appearance on the regulatory platform points toward an imminent launch.
While the company has yet to officially confirm its specifications, previous leaks and benchmark listings have revealed several key details.
Reports suggest the Galaxy S27 will be powered by Qualcomm’s Snapdragon 6 Gen 3 processor paired with 6GB of RAM. The device is also expected to run Android 16 out of the box with Samsung’s latest One UI skin on top, offering a modern software experience and reliable day-to-day performance.
The upcoming smartphone is rumored to feature a 6.7-inch Full HD+ AMOLED display with a 120Hz refresh rate. In terms of design, the Galaxy A27 is tipped to follow the styling of the Galaxy A37 and Galaxy A57. This means buyers can expect a punch-hole display design instead of the older notch-style implementation seen on some previous models.
For photography, Samsung is expected to equip the device with a triple rear camera setup comprising a 50-megapixel primary sensor, an 8-megapixel ultra-wide camera, and a 2-megapixel macro lens. The inclusion of three rear cameras could help the Galaxy A27 stand out in a segment where many competing smartphones have shifted to simpler dual-camera systems.
Samsung‘s official announcement regarding this model is still awaited. So, more information about pricing, availability, and final specifications is expected to surface in the coming weeks.
